JPL’s Acquisition Division acquires all goods and services that support Jet Propulsion Laboratory’s projects, missions, and critical institutional needs. Acquisition manages approximately $1.6–$2B in annual expenditures on behalf of the Laboratory. Due to the scope and complexity of these activities, Acquisition operations are subject to extensive oversight from both internal and external audit entities.
Procurement files and records are regularly reviewed as part of required annual audits and periodic compliance reviews conducted by organizations including PricewaterhouseCoopers (PwC), the Defense Contract Audit Agency (DCAA), the Defense Contract Management Agency (DCMA), and other federal oversight entities.
